COLTS SEND BUONOMO TO SAULT STE. MARIE

Press Release

The Barrie Colts have announced today that they have completed a trade with Sault Ste. Marie Greyhounds. 

The Barrie Colts obtain Sault Ste. Marie’s 4th round pick in the 2014.

In exchange the Colts send the Sault Ste. Marie Greyhounds, defenseman Chris Buonomo.
Buonomo was originally drafted by the Peterborough Petes, a 3rd round choice (46th overall) in 2008. Barrie acquired Buonomo on November 18, 2010 from Peterborough along with Guelph’s 5th round choice in 2011 for Barrie’s 10th round choice in 2011 and a 4th round choice in 2013.

Chris Buonomo is now off to play in his hometown Sault Ste. Marie: joining his third OHL team in five seasons. Chris played 108 regular season games in a Colts uniform and 13 playoff games.
In 194 career games in the OHL Buonomo has 32 points and 323 penalty minutes.
